Skip plating problems

September 25, 2008

We are doing plastic chrome plating here in the philippines for more than a year.
We encountered skip plating just like pittings after copper sulfate. what is the cause of that? can u help me?

September 30, 2008

Joemer,
In copper sulfate baths skip plating is usually caused by excessive organics that interfere with the leveling of the deposit. I would carbon treat the bath, add back additives per hull cell tests. Also check to make sure the bath agitation is sufficient. Good Luck!
